Art Machine, a division of Trailer Park Group, is a fully integrated advertising agency dedicated to building fans for brands and entertainment properties. We have built a great reputation on award-winning creative, great service, and a fun and energetic culture–and we may be looking for you to join our team!
We are seeking a talented Account Coordinator with a can-do attitude to join our team. This person will support many film, TV, and streaming accounts, supporting a dedicated Account team and design team and driving the client’s projects forward. The workload for these accounts includes its share of original creative and production management. This means you’ll need to be extremely organized, detail-oriented, and be able to handle multiple projects at one time.
WHAT YOU WILL DO:
• Function as back-up point of contact for clients.
• Manage upward to ensure the account leadership roles within the team are supported.
• Maintain and manage all ingoing and outgoing of client-supplied assets within scope and timeline.
• Open, close, and track the status for all projects..
• Delegate all necessary assets and information to design, photo, planning and production teams.
• Maintain project oversight and ensuring proper quality control during project’s lifespan.
• Schedule all internal and external meetings.
• Disseminate information clearly and concisely while keeping the team engaged.
• Provide administrative support for all billing requests and invoice submissions.
• Tracks project-specific resource availability with the Planning team.
WHAT YOU WILL NEED:
• Excellent organizational and time management skills, having forethought to plan ahead.
• Strong computer skills and understanding of latest OSX operating systems.
• Meticulous, result-oriented and customer-focused with a passion for the creative process.
• Ability to communicate well both verbally and in writing with clients, vendors and internal team.
• Good analytical, problem-solving and troubleshooting skills.
• Consistent follow-through, ability to traffic communication and ensure project accuracy.
• A positive demeanor while under pressure to meet demanding deadlines.
• Takes direction and constructive feedback well and can perform assigned tasks promptly and productively.
• 1-3 years of related industry experience. Agency experience preferred.
